The latest officially reported population of India was 1,463,865,525 in 2025 vs 6,549,143 people in Serbia in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current India's population is 1,483,314,140 people compared to 6,500,256 in Serbia.

Population statistics:

  • India's population is 228.2 times bigger than Serbia's.
  • India is ranked the 1st most populous country in the world, while Serbia is the 110th.
  • The countries together account for 17.9% of the world: 17.9% for India vs 0.08% for Serbia.
  • For the last 10 years, India has had an average growth rate of +1% per year vs -0.77% in Serbia.
  • Since 2006, the population of India has increased from 1.17B people to 1.48B (26.5% growth), while Serbia has declined from 7.41M to 6.5M (12.3% decline).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of India increased by 171,065,406 people (a 14.6% growth), while Serbia lost 353,247 people (a 4.77% decline).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, India gained 139,369,844 people (a 10.4% growth), while Serbia's population decreased by 558,066 people (a 7.91% decline).

India was ranked 2nd most populous country in 2006 and is 1st in 2026. Serbia was ranked 97th in 2006 and ranked 110th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) India's population will grow by 13.6% to 1,685,088,884 people and will still be ranked 1st. The population of Serbia will decrease by 16.7% to 5,417,847 people and rank change from 110th to 125th.

India is projected to reach its peak in 2062 at 1.71B people, while Serbia's population already peaked in 1990 at 7.9M people and is projected to decrease to 3.62M people by 2100.

Over the last 10 years, 96.1% of the population change in India is from natural causes (a gain of 142,967,525 people) and 3.89% is from migration (a loss of 5,780,451 people). In Serbia 85.1% is from natural causes (a loss of 437,745 people) and 14.9% is from migration (a loss of 76,396 people).

As of 2024, 4,796,255 residents or 0.3% of the population were not native-born in India, compared to 712,550 people or 10.6% in Serbia.
